Cell phone jammers are devices designed to block or disrupt mobile communications by emitting signals that interfere with the operation of cell phones within their range. The primary purpose of a cell phone jammer is to prevent cellular signals from being transmitted or received, effectively rendering mobile phones inoperable in the affected area. This can be useful in various settings, such as in sensitive environments where unwanted calls and messages could be disruptive or where maintaining a quiet atmosphere is crucial.

Cell phone jammers work by generating radio frequency interference (RFI) that overwhelms the frequencies used by mobile phones. By doing so, they create a signal environment that prevents the cell phone from establishing a connection with the nearest cell tower. This can be particularly useful in locations such as conference rooms, theaters, hospitals, or any environment where the presence of mobile phones could cause interference or disruption.

The effectiveness of a cell phone jammer largely depends on its power output, the design of its antennas, and its ability to cover the desired range. Is It Legal to Have a Jammer?

The legality of owning and using a jammer varies depending on your location. In many countries, including the United States and the European Union, the use of jammers is highly regulated or outright illegal. The primary concern is that jammers interfere with licensed communications, such as emergency services and cellular networks. In the United States, the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) prohibits the use of any device that transmits radio signals without authorization, including jammers. This is to prevent disruption of critical communications systems and ensure public safety. In contrast, some countries may have more lenient regulations, but it’s crucial to check local laws before purchasing or using a jammer. Always consult legal experts or local authorities to understand the specific regulations in your area to avoid potential fines or legal issues.

Can a Jammer Be Traced?

Yes, jammers can potentially be traced, especially if they are used in a way that causes significant interference. Law enforcement agencies and regulatory bodies have the tools and techniques to detect and locate sources of interference. While sophisticated jammers might be harder to trace due to their advanced technology, simpler or improperly shielded jammers can emit signals that are detectable by frequency scanners. Authorities often use these tools to identify the source of interference and take appropriate action. If a jammer is suspected of disrupting critical communications or violating regulations, it can lead to investigations and legal consequences. How Far Can a Cell Phone Jammer Go?

The range of a cell phone jammer can vary widely based on its design and power. Typically, cell phone jammers can have effective ranges from a few meters to several hundred meters. Basic or low-power jammers might only affect devices within a small area, such as a single room, while more powerful models can cover a larger distance. High-power jammers used for extensive coverage can interfere with cellular signals over several hundred meters. However, the effectiveness of a cell phone jammer can be influenced by factors such as the strength of the cellular signal, environmental conditions, and the presence of obstacles.
